Please note that the values given in the video for the mean solar radii of both Earth and Jupiter are correct if the units are kilometers (km), NOT meters. Earth's mean orbital radius from the Sun is 1.5x10^11 m = 1.5x10^8 km. Because a ratio is being used in Kepler's 3rd Law, the effect of these two errors cancel each other out.

One thing that i find slightly troubling is that kids are taught that th planets orbits are eliptical using exaggerations, so they never truly appreciate how incredibly circular they are. If one were to draw a perfect representation of earths path with a 200mm major axis, and on a transparancy draw a circle 200mm dia, one figure could not be distinguished from th other, even with a ruler.(earths major axis is 99.986% of its minor: so on our drawing, no point on th circle>>
